Vikings Beat Lancers To Improve To 6-3

Parker 42, Madison La Foleltte 14, Friday, October 17, 2011 at Monterey Stadium









Glimpses from the 2011 Homecoming Parade


Madison La Follette's tough defense made life unpleasant for Parker in the first half. Parker led 14-6 at the half thanks to a stellar defensive effort by Coach Dick Schuh's defense. Above left: Adam Vesterfelt finished the night with 217 rushing yards. This broke broke the Janesville City career rushing record set by Parker's Cas Prime. Prime had recorded 5,209 rsuhing yards. Vesterfelt now has 5,248 yards rushing with at least one game remaining.
